Abstract. In this article, some aspects of the development of students' creative activities in the calculation of exponential arithmetic roots, nth-order arithmetic roots, and 3rd-order roots are considered, and concrete properties and applications of each studied method in teaching algebra are discussed. examples are considered
Keywords: degree, arithmetic root, square root, cube root n-degree root and its properties
